Re: bubbles in the cooling system.

Kyle called this AM and suggested that I dismantle my compression checker and blow 30 to 40 psi back into the cylinders to check for bubbles.

After taking out the schraeder valve inside, connecting the hose to the plug hole, finding top dead center on each cylinder, .....

no bubbles in the expansion tank. Thank god. Well, I guess it was pretty late last night so .... I don't want to say I panicked or anything......

Onward to solve the fuel pump/filter issue and rebuild the alternator.
